WebThese knots are all great for snelling hooks for use in Spinning Harnesses. If your hook does not have an offset eye, use the Traditional Snell Knot only passing the line through the eye once or not at all, the Uni-knot Snell Knot or the Easy Snell Knot. WebThe Snell Knot allows the leader, or tippet, to be directly tied to a baited hook. This fishing knot was originally invented for use with eyeless hooks but it is still widely used today.
